title = "On computing minimal E L-subsumption modules",
abstract = "In the paper we study algorithms for computing minimal modules that are minimal w.r.t. set inclusion and that preserve the entailment of all E L-subsumptions over a signature of interest. We follow the black-box approach for finding one or all justifications by replacing the entailment tests with logical difference checks, obtaining modules that preserve not only a given consequence but all entailments over a signature. Such minimal modules can serve to improve our understanding of the internal structure of large and complex ontologies. Additionally, several optimisations to speed up the computation of minimal modules are investigated. We present an experimental evaluation of an implementation of our algorithms by applying them on the medical ontologies Snomed CT and NCI.",
